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ree Medical Technology
  • Medical Technologist 3-5 years
  • Medical Laboratory Scientist - American Society of Clinical Pathologists
  • Demonstrated competency in routine testing in assigned Laboratory area, applies comprehensive technical knowledge to carry out more complex assignments.
  • Ability to effectively relate and communicate with internal and external customers.
  • Basic knowledge of laboratory information systems.
  • Ability to organize tasks and projects and work without close supervision to complete tasks.

Responsibilities

  • Performs accurate and appropriate testing of specimens received in the laboratory, according to established laboratory protocol and procedures.
  • Reports test results in a timely manner according to established laboratory protocols.
  • Follows established procedures for laboratory quality control, ensures compliance with regulatory requirements, quality standards, compliance activities, and policies and procedures.
  • Effectively manages resources such as productivity, supplies, instruments and equipment.
  • Plans work and completes job responsibilities in an efficient and productive manner.
  • Performs multiple administrative functions in support of Laboratory operations OR performs as a Technical Specialist as the expert in a complex testing area.
